Procida, the smallest of the main islands in the Gulf of Naples, is a hidden gem still far from mass tourism. This picturesque island, located between Ischia and the Campanian coast, offers an authentic and intimate experience for those looking to explore its hidden corners and enjoy genuine Italian hospitality.

Upon arrival, visitors are greeted by pastel-colored houses overlooking the Marina Grande harbor. Strolling through the narrow alleys, one can discover glimpses of daily life and immerse in the relaxing atmosphere of the island. Don’t miss a visit to the Church of Santa Maria delle Grazie, with its panoramic location that offers a spectacular view of the sea and the Campanian archipelago.

For sea lovers, Procida boasts a number of enchanting beaches; Pozzo Vecchio beach, also known as the "Postino Beach" thanks to the famous film shot here, is a charming bay of dark sand surrounded by lush Mediterranean vegetation. Chiaia beach, on the other hand, is perfect for families due to its gently sloping seabed and stunning views of the Avalos Castle.

Finally, one cannot leave Procida without tasting the local cuisine. Specialties such as the Procidana rabbit, local lemons, and handmade desserts like "Lingue di Bue" will delight every palate.
